Gas sensors play a crucial role in ensuring safety and environmental protection by detecting harmful gases in various settings. These devices are essential in industries, homes, and laboratories, helping to monitor air quality and prevent hazardous situations. By utilizing advanced technology, gas sensors can identify a wide range of gases, including carbon monoxide, methane, and volatile organic compounds (VOCs).
Understanding how gas sensors work is vital for anyone concerned about air quality and safety. They typically operate using different sensing technologies such as electrochemical, infrared, or semiconductor methods. Users can choose from portable or fixed gas sensors depending on their specific needs.
